There is only a very slight change required to the OS to enable the memory expansion board. I will just add some test code to identify if the expansion board is fitted, and have the OS reconfigure automatically. So there should be a single build of v4 that will run on either standard or expanded P3s. But to be clear, the expansion board only increases the memory capacity for pattern storage - it can't increase the available code space. v4 is still slightly smaller than v3, so there is room for a few more features yet.
